In April 2025, Vancouver hosted North America’s 50 Best Bars for the very first time and when the world’s most respected cocktail writers, bartenders, and spirits professionals arrived in the city, they discovered what locals have quietly known for a decade: that Vancouver’s bar scene is genuinely world-class. Two Vancouver venues ranked directly on the global list. More than a dozen others were named among the finest discovery bars on the continent. The city delivered not just a great host week but proof of concept  that a Pacific Northwest city of two and a half million had built one of the most sophisticated and creative cocktail cultures in North America. Botanist Bar at the Fairmont Pacific Rim is the most decorated cocktail bar in Vancouver history — ranked #26 on North America’s 50 Best Bars 2025, winner of the Michter’s Art of Hospitality Award, and holder of the Michelin Exceptional Cocktails recognition. Under Creative Beverage Director Grant Sceney, the Cocktail Lab produces theatre-meets-science experiences where edible cherry-blossom clouds drift on cocktails, botanicals are suspended in glass spheres, and every drink tells a story about the Pacific Northwest. The menu changes seasonally, foraging local BC ingredients. Spirit-free cocktails are equally inventive. The botanical-garden interior is one of the most beautiful bar rooms in the city.

The Keefer Bar is one of Vancouver’s most celebrated cocktail institutions — an apothecary-inspired bar in the heart of Chinatown ranked #25 on North America’s 50 Best Bars 2025 and voted Canada’s 2nd best bar for three consecutive years. The cocktail menu is modelled on traditional Chinese apothecary prescriptions, featuring housemade tinctures, exotic spices, and premium spirits in over 25 unique seasonal cocktails. The Blood Moon (Botanist gin, blood orange, Szechuan peppercorn syrup, egg white) is among the most discussed cocktails in the city. Happy hour daily 4–6PM with cocktails from $10–$14 and dim sum plates.

Laowai is one of the most thrilling bar experiences in Vancouver — a Prohibition-era 1920s Shanghai-inspired speakeasy hidden behind a faux freezer door inside the BLND TGER dumpling shop on East Georgia Street. To enter: walk into the dumpling shop and ask for “table 7” — the freezer door opens to emerald-green velvet walls, copper fixtures, leather banquettes, and malachite-topped surfaces transporting you to golden-era Shanghai. Every cocktail spans two illustrated pages with historical inspiration, featuring bamboo, ginseng, lychee, and Sichuan peppercorn. Canada’s most extensive baijiu selection. Named a 50 Best Discovery Bar.

Bagheera is the sister speakeasy to Laowai — named for the black panther in Rudyard Kipling’s The Jungle Book, inspired by India at the turn of the 20th century. This hidden 60-seat cocktail lounge at 518 Main Street is accessed through the Happy Valley Turf Club betting shop: enter and place a wager on “King Louie” to gain entry. Inside: a 45-foot hand-painted jungle mural covers the ceiling, a 42-foot golden bar anchors the room, and a Drawing Room houses a Cabinet of Curiosities filled with rare whiskies. The cocktail menu features saffron gin, smoked paprika tinctures, and an exceptional Gin & Tonic section.

Guilt & Co. is Gastown’s most beloved underground bar and Vancouver’s premier live music venue — an atmospheric candlelit subterranean space in Maple Tree Square that has hosted nightly performances every single night since 2010. Live music seven nights a week spans jazz, swing, soul, cabaret, blues, and touring acts. Entry is pay-what-you-can for most shows. Rock legends including Imagine Dragons, the Pixies, and Dave Grohl have stopped in. The craft cocktails, artisan cheese plates, and real stemware in a brick underground setting create a genuinely romantic and irreplaceable atmosphere.

The Shameful Tiki Room on Main Street is one of the most joyful bar experiences in Vancouver — a lovingly crafted 1,200-square-foot, 50-seat tiki paradise reviving golden-age Polynesian lounge culture since 2013. Over 35 classic tiki cocktails including Navy Grogs, Painkillers, Zombies, and the house-special Day of the Dead are crafted with genuine expertise and served in ceramic vessels. The enormous shared fire punch bowls, lit ablaze tableside for groups of four or more, are a Vancouver bucket-list moment. Live surf and Hawaiian music plays on selected evenings. No phone line — book online. Reservations essential, especially weekends.

Pourhouse is one of Gastown’s most beautiful and enduring bars — housed in a magnificent heritage building dating to 1910, with original pressed tin ceilings, antique wood panelling, and vintage fixtures that create authentic historical character no modern fit-out can replicate. The cocktail programme is rooted in pre-Prohibition classics: a textbook Sidecar, a smoky Old Fashioned, and a Daiquiri made with fresh lime. Dave Grohl, the Pixies, and Imagine Dragons have all stopped in for after-show drinks. Live music on Fridays and Saturdays, full kitchen until late.

Prophecy Cocktail Bar at the Rosewood Hotel Georgia is one of Vancouver’s most exciting premium cocktail destinations — a subterranean bar featuring Michelin Guide-awarded bartenders Jeff Savage and Nicole Cote, and a seasonal cocktail programme that pushes the boundaries of flavour and presentation. The Prohibition-inspired design includes original sliding wooden door panels on the entrance. Happy hour runs daily 4–6PM. A curated live music programme adds electric energy to evenings. The most sophisticated and dramatically designed bar experience in downtown Vancouver. Enter via Howe Street.

The Sylvia Hotel Cocktail Lounge holds a distinction no other bar in Vancouver can claim: it is the city’s very first cocktail lounge, having opened in 1954 inside the historic ivy-covered English Bay Sylvia Hotel — a heritage landmark since 1912. Sitting on the ground floor with a patio that looks directly over English Bay, the Sylvia Lounge is the quintessential Vancouver romantic bar: deeply cozy furnishings, warm lighting, historic photographs, and 70 years of history creating an atmosphere no modern bar can manufacture. The patio sunsets over English Bay are among the most beautiful views from any bar in the city. Dog-friendly. Open daily.

Bartholomew Bar on Mainland Street in Yaletown was named a North America’s 50 Best Discovery Bar in 2025 — confirming what locals already knew about this sleek modern cocktail bar building one of the most inventive programmes in the city. The bar team’s commitment to seasonal BC ingredients, fermentation techniques, and creative spirit pairings produces drinks of genuine complexity and surprise. Elevated bar snacks including oysters, charcuterie, and carefully sourced cheese are among the finest bar food in Yaletown. An intimate design-forward space with an air of discovery about it every evening.

How do you get into the Vancouver speakeasies?

Laowai (251 E Georgia St): Enter the BLND TGER dumpling shop and ask for “table 7” — the freezer door opens. Bagheera (518 Main St): Enter the Happy Valley Turf Club betting shop and place a wager on “King Louie.” Both are walk-in only — arrive early on weekends as capacity is limited to around 60 seats each.

Which Vancouver bars have the best happy hour?

The Keefer Bar runs the finest happy hour in Vancouver daily 4–6PM: cocktails from $10–$14 and discounted dim sum plates. Prophecy Cocktail Bar at the Rosewood also runs daily 4–6PM happy hour with premium cocktails in a stunning setting. Botanist Bar’s bar seating is available without a dinner reservation for walk-ins throughout the evening.

Which Vancouver bar is best for live music?

Guilt & Co. at 1 Alexander Street in Gastown is the undisputed best bar for live music in Vancouver, hosting performances seven nights a week since 2010 across jazz, swing, soul, and touring acts. Entry is pay-what-you-can for most shows. Pourhouse on Water Street offers live music on Fridays and Saturdays. Prophecy has a curated live music programme on select evenings.
